Doug Brams

UX Lead at The Home Depot

Doug Brams is a seasoned professional with over 25 years of experience in enhancing user experiences for consumer products, software, and websites, along with 15 years of expertise in mobile technology.

His educational background includes a Master's degree in Human Computer Interaction from Carnegie Mellon University, a ScB Honors in Psychology and Cognitive Science from Brown University, and two years in a Neuroscience Ph.D. program at Brandeis University.

Doug has held various roles in prestigious organizations such as The Home Depot, Brandeis University, UX Headquarters LLC, Georgia Institute of Technology, Altisource, Mobiquity Inc., Fiserv, THINK Interactive, Inc., Earthlink, Netscape, T-Mobile, Maxartists, AOL, Indaba, Pixo, Nokia Mobile Phones R&D, NASA, Microsoft, and Deloitte Consulting.

His notable projects include contributions to products such as Apple iPod, AOL Wireless Instant Messaging, T9 Text Input, The Weather Channel App, various Nokia phone models, MS Publisher, Windows CE, Interactive TV, Netscape.com, Earthlink.net, T-Mobile Caller Tunes, T-Mobile UMA phones, RIM Blackberry phones, and Homedepot.com.

Doug has also been involved in academia as an Adjunct Faculty at Brandeis University and by contributing to the program development and advisory boards of various institutions focused on user-centered design.

His expertise ranges from UX design, usability research, mobile web development, cart and checkout experiences, user-centered design, and internet of things, among others. With a strong foundation in human-computer interaction and psychology, Doug has a diverse skill set that spans across industries and technologies in the realm of user experience.
